Monte Margarida
Monte Margarida is a village in Rochoso e Monte Margarida, Guarda. Monte Margarida is situated nearby to the village Penedo da Sé, as well as near the hamlet Peroficós.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Albardo
Village
Albardo is a former civil parish in the municipality of Guarda. In 2013, the parish merged into the new parish Pousade e Albardo. The population in 2011 was 143, in an area of 4.05 km². Albardo is situated 6 km west of Monte Margarida.
